Thomas Jennings, Fritwell. A mid 18th century oak thirty hour longcase clock H.177cm

Thomas Jennings, Fritwell. A mid 18th century oak thirty hour longcase clock H.177cm
Estimate £60-90

Marriage, in poor condition, no weight and damaged pendulum.
Workings seized up with verdigris but look complete, bottom left of dial has chip losses, oak country case missing cornice and section of base.

The workings sit on the remains of a wooden bed, a strip about an inch or so wide.
